JOB DESCRIPTION
Division:              Children, Youth and Family Services
Position:              ChOICE Academy Educational Instructor –High School Language Arts
Supervision:      Non-supervisory
Reports to:         CYFS School & Tutorial Education Coordinator   
SUMMARY OF POSITION: This position entails teaching high school language arts at an independent therapeutic school with small class sizes, providing opportunities for personalized and hands-on instruction. The role involves fostering students' love for language and literature, nurturing critical thinking skills, and creating an innovative and supportive learning environment.

SPECIFIC DUTIES & RESPONSIBILITIES: 
  • Design and implement academic curriculum and instruction appropriate to each student in the classroom. 
  • Requisition necessary teaching materials and equipment, within the available budget.
  • Implement social and behavioral programming for each student in the classroom.
  • Develop positive and therapeutic working relationships with youth, families and staff.
  • Communicate well with all parties involved with the youth, both verbally and in writing.
  • Accept and respond to administrative and professional supervision.
  • Complete all Academy and agency required paperwork completely and in a timely manner.
  • Work consistently within the program's mission.
  • Follow and implement all Academy and agency policies and procedures.
  • Willingness to learn de-escalation and passive restraint techniques.
  • Ability to restrain youth who are a danger to self or others.
  • Work consistently within the mission of the program
  • Perform other duties as assigned by the Education Coordinator.

QUALIFICATIONS: 
Education:
  • Bachelor's or master's degree, with a teaching license in the appropriate area of instructional specialization, grades 7-12 preferred.
  • Bachelor’s degree with extensive knowledge (18 college credits) and experience in instructional specialization with teaching experience required. 
  • Teachers meeting Vermont’s Highly Qualified standard preferred.

Experience:
  • Teaching experience with children with severe emotional and behavioral challenges or other mental health issues preferred.
  • Excellent verbal and written communication skills.
  • Ability to work independently and as part of a team.
  • Able to execute both verbal and physical restraint de-escalation techniques or willingness to learn de-escalation techniques.
  • Able to move around the office/classroom and occasionally traverse outdoor setting up to one mile in a continuous session.
  • Able to remain in a stationary position 50% of the time. 
  • Able to move items up to 50 pounds around the office/classroom for various needs.
